It is a very interesting book that describes the challenges being faced by many of young women enter pruners in Ethiopia. The book also thoroughly assess the prospects of women entrepreneurs in Micro and Small Enterprises in Dessie City. it's revealed in the book that the women entrepreneurs have good prospects that encourage them to create their own businesses; they have plans to improve their enterprises and positive societal attitude towards women entrepreneur. On the other hand, the main challenges that hinder women enterprises were found to be lack of information access, unreasonable interest rate charged by micro finance and other lending institution, no affiliation from women organization, and lack of access to finance, lack of practical training, entrepreneurs and dual responsibility.
